Built Environment

PLMR’s Built Environment team delivers timely, impactful, and effective communications to clients daily, including on the most challenging and sensitive of briefs. The team’s work spans public affairs, PR, media relations, stakeholder engagement, community consultation, digital communications, crisis communications, and reputation management across the sector.

Best known for our intelligent, analytical, and bespoke approach to every campaign we work on, we deliver the communications’ strategies needed to engage with local communities and decision-makers to successfully secure your aims, whether that is planning consent, a local plan allocation, or improved relationships with stakeholders.

We offer a full suite of communication services to clients ranging from smaller landowners to the biggest housebuilders in the UK, including digital engagement through website creation, our bespoke online consultation tool Mapdragon, virtual exhibition rooms, interactive PDFs, and social media projects, as well as public relations strategies and public affairs campaigns across our regional networks.

Galliford Try Investments brought forward plans for a major regeneration scheme at the former Corah Factory site in Leicester city centre. PLMR was appointed to build support among key stakeholders and the local community to help secure planning approval from Leicester CC.
North Herts Council appointed PLMR to support consultation on the Churchgate Regeneration Zone in Hitchin. The goal was to gather views from stakeholders and the community on the site’s future redevelopment.
